currently, the plastic, galvanized, mild steel and concrete tanks are being used to store water for drinking purpose but the stored water in these tanks is not safe and hygienic for consumption mainly because the materials being used to manufacture these tanks are porous, which in turn helps the growth of bacteria, fungus and algae leading to water contamination.
The water temperature increases significantly in plastic tanks in summer season. The mirror finish material that we use for the tank manufacturing reflects the heat and sun's rays, therefore resisting an alarming increase in temperature. In addition, it is a challenge to clean these tanks regularly and thoroughly. Hence the prevailing method of storing drinking water for domestic consumption is very harmful. Moreover, Stainless Steel has longer life span whereas plastic tanks required replacements at least 5 to 10 times in one's life.
